Summary
Three square plastic-bodied earthenware tiles, coated in white slip and decorated with hand-transferred underglaze 'Persian' colours: black, green, yellow, purple and olive/brown. One of the tiles is missing and, according to the sketch for the design, should have had a design of a large carnation surrounded by scrolling foliage. The remaining two tiles have the second part of the design, consisting of green foliage with Turkish-/Iznik-style serrated leaves and yellow buds; they both have the same design, but in mirror image to each other and differing slightly in detail. The word 'carnation' is pencilled on the reverse of one tile.
